📉 Fed Cuts Rates: Down (last decision: 0.25% cut on Dec 10, 2025)📊 10-Year Treasury Rate: ~4.25% (as of Jan 22, 2026)
✅ Yes, the market is correcting.IMO, the housing data on median home prices (and especially the news) is skewed because so many new-construction homes were purchased last year, and because of delistings.
A lot of listings were pulled off the market because they couldn’t get what they wanted, which is a pretty good indication that, if sold, they would have negatively affected stats.
✨Bottom line (IMO): We should see more home UNITS sold in 2026, but I project appraisal-value growth of -1% to +2%.
✅ Yes, some homes still go Day 1, and yes, there are still some bidding wars in highly desired neighborhoods… but a lot of folks want to live in a fairytale land and believe this happens everywhere. It doesn’t.
